Chicken cutlet in batter

1
We mix egg, flour, and mayonnaise.
- Chicken egg (large): 1 piece
- Wheat flour: 1 tablespoon
- Mayonnaise: 1 tablespoon
2
Add 3 cloves of garlic, minced in a garlic press.
- Garlic: 3 cloves
3
We season with spices and salt with pepper.
- Curry: to taste
- Salt: to taste
- Ground black pepper: to taste
4
Take the boneless chicken fillet cut into small pieces, dip it in the prepared mixture, place the pieces in a preheated pan with oil, and fry for 4-5 minutes on each side over medium heat.
- Chicken fillet: 3 pieces
5
The chicken turns out tender inside and with a golden crust outside.
6
Best served with potatoes.
